- [ ] Show the new starter the mail room's new home! It's moved from the second floor down to the basement, next to the old print hub at Larkspur House. Walk them down, point out the sorting shelves, and make sure they know parcels get logged on arrival. The basement door needs the current pass code, which is:

door code, yagap-bahof: bdg-O-05

The Spindlehook scanner flags packages whose names sit within a small edit distance of high-download targets on the Ferrant registry. Scoring combines edit distance, download-count asymmetry, maintainer age, and install-script presence. Anything above the block threshold is quarantined pending manual review; the warn band only annotates. Reviewers should note that thresholds were calibrated against six months of confirmed squatting incidents and deliberately favor false positives. The current calibrated constants are as follows.

tuning constants:
TIERS = {
    "sorion": 670,
    "istax": 547,
}

Migration Step 4 — Regenerate the static-analysis baseline

After merging the Copperleaf 3.x upgrade, the old `baseline.sarif` is invalid — the rule IDs changed wholesale. Delete it, run `copperleaf scan --write-baseline`, and commit the result in the same PR. Reviewers: reject any diff that edits the baseline by hand. The scan also records suppression history in the audit database; it picks up credentials from the connection string below.

primary connection of yagep-kahip = redis://giliel_svc:zYiKsLL2PLpfPL@db-348f.xolmarsys.corp:5432/fenwyn